A Texas judge has dismissed a misdemeanor gun charge against NBA player James Harden after he completed an alternative resolution program. Harden was arrested in June for having a handgun in his vehicle without a license, which is a misdemeanor under
Texas law. The dismissal follows Harden's participation in a program that allows defendants to avoid a criminal record through community service. The case highlights the legal challenges faced by public figures and the role of alternative resolution programs in the justice system.
